Sydney to repurpose defunct industrial space for park

The city of Sydney has plans to develop its own version of New York City’s High Line park, a community park built on a defunct elevated railway line. The five hundred metre project, which will begin construction next June if approved, is part of Sydney’s Ultimo Pedestrian Network.
